The Evolution of Car Keys
1. Conventional Keys:
In the early days of automotive history, car keys were simple metal cut keys, utilized exclusively to mechanically open doors and start the vehicle. These standard keys were easy to replicate but didn't use much in terms of security.
2. Transponder Keys:
Introduced in the mid-1990s, transponder keys revolutionized automotive security. Embedded with a microchip, these keys send out a special signal to the car's ignition system. Cars will only start if they recognize the appropriate signal, adding a layer of security versus theft.
3. Remote Key Fobs:
Remote key fobs enable keyless entry, making it hassle-free for users to access their vehicles with the touch of a button. These fobs usually likewise control car alarms, offering additional security functions.
4. view it Smart Keys and Keyless Ignition:
The latest in automotive key technology, clever keys or distance keys permit users to start and stop the vehicle with a push-button ignition system. They enable the vehicle to acknowledge when the key is close by, using unparalleled benefit and security.
The Role of a Car Locksmith
Car locksmiths are extremely knowledgeable professionals who concentrate on a variety of services. Here are some of their main responsibilities:
Key Replacement and Duplication:
Whether due to loss, theft, or damage, replacing car keys is among the most common jobs performed by locksmith professionals. With their expertise, they can duplicate and replace standard, transponder, and even some clever keys.
Lockout Services:
Being locked out of a vehicle is a common predicament faced by lots of motorists. Locksmiths utilize specialized tools and techniques to safely open car doors without causing any damage.
Ignition Repair and Replacement:
Issues with a car's ignition system can prevent a vehicle from beginning. Locksmiths assess these issues and can repair or replace ignitions as necessary.
Programming Transponder Keys:
Given the intricacy associated with transponder keys, locksmith professionals typically help with programming them to communicate with a vehicle's ignition system.
Advanced Security System Installation:
Modern automobiles frequently come geared up with advanced security systems. Car locksmith professionals use installation and maintenance services for these advanced systems to guarantee they operate correctly.
The Technology Behind Lock and Key Security
Advancements in innovation have actually changed how locksmiths work. Here's a look into some of the key technologies utilized today:
Laser Key Cutting: Laser cutting devices are utilized for high accuracy, guaranteeing keys fit perfectly into their particular locks.
OBD-II Programming Tools: On-Board Diagnostics (OBD) tools assist locksmith professionals in accessing a car's computer system to program keys, especially for more recent designs.
Key Code Retrieval: Modern locksmith professionals can retrieve distinct car key codes from producers, making it possible for precise duplication and programming.
FAQs About Car Key and Locksmith Services
What should I do if I lose my car keys?
- Contact a professional locksmith who can replace your keys. Make sure to provide evidence of ownership for the vehicle.
Can a locksmith make a key for a car without the initial?
- Yes, many locksmiths can develop a key utilizing the vehicle's ignition lock or by recovering the key code.
For how long does it require to replace a car key?
- The time can differ depending upon the key type and the locksmith's availability, with conventional keys taking less time compared to transponder and smart keys.
Is it cheaper to go to a locksmith or a car dealership for key replacement?
- Generally, locksmiths provide more cost-effective services compared to dealers for key replacement services.
Can locksmiths program all types of car keys?
- While many locksmith professionals can deal with a wide variety of keys, some high-tech designs might need specific services readily available only through the car dealership.
